Overview of the Jmgo O1 Pro
The Jmgo O1 Pro is a compact 4K projector designed for home entertainment. It boasts a bright, high-resolution display, a sleek design, and smart features that make it a popular choice among consumers. Its native 4K resolution ensures crisp images, while its brightness levels support vibrant colors even in well-lit rooms.
Key Features of the Jmgo O1 Pro
- Native 4K resolution (3840 x 2160)
- High brightness of 2200 lumens
- HDR support for enhanced contrast
- Built-in Android TV for streaming
- Compact and portable design
- Multiple connectivity options including HDMI and USB
Performance in 4K Content
The Jmgo O1 Pro delivers sharp, detailed images with vibrant colors, making it suitable for watching 4K movies, sports, and gaming. Its HDR support enhances contrast and color accuracy, providing a more immersive experience. The projector’s brightness allows for clear images even in rooms with ambient light, although optimal performance is achieved in darker environments.
Comparison with Rivals
BenQ TK700ST
The BenQ TK700ST offers 4K resolution with a slightly higher brightness of 3000 lumens, making it excellent for brightly lit rooms. It features low input lag, ideal for gaming, and robust color accuracy. However, its size and price are generally higher than the Jmgo O1 Pro.
Epson Home Cinema 5050UB
This model is renowned for its superb image quality and excellent contrast ratio. It supports 4K content through pixel shifting and has advanced color processing. While it offers superior picture quality, it is larger and more expensive, targeting premium home theater setups.
Performance Summary
The Jmgo O1 Pro provides a compelling balance of 4K resolution, portability, and smart features at a competitive price point. While rivals like the BenQ TK700ST excel in brightness and gaming performance, and Epson models lead in picture quality, the O1 Pro is well-suited for casual to moderate enthusiasts seeking a versatile, high-quality projector.
